On December 14, 1799, George Washington, the primary President of america, handed away on the age of 67. His demise got here as a shock to the nation, and many individuals have been left questioning what had prompted the sudden demise of this beloved chief.

The official reason behind Washington’s demise was “a extreme irritation in his throat” which was then known as “quincy”, now generally known as epiglottitis. This situation is a swelling of the epiglottis, a small flap of tissue that covers the opening to the larynx (voice field) when swallowing. When the epiglottis turns into infected, it will possibly block the airway, making it troublesome to breathe.

Washington had been affected by a sore throat and cough for a number of days earlier than his demise. On December 12, 1799, he was examined by a physician who identified him with “a violent irritation of the throat” and prescribed a remedy of bloodletting and calomel. Nevertheless, Washington’s situation worsened, and he died two days later.

There’s some debate about whether or not Washington’s demise was attributable to pure causes or by medical malpractice. Some historians imagine that the bloodletting and calomel remedies might have really hastened his demise. Others imagine that Washington’s demise was inevitable, given the severity of his situation.

Quincy (epiglottitis)

Quincy is an old school time period for epiglottitis, a situation by which the epiglottis, a small flap of tissue that covers the opening to the larynx (voice field) when swallowing, turns into infected and swollen. This swelling can block the airway, making it troublesome to breathe.

  • Signs: Epiglottitis could cause quite a lot of signs, together with sore throat, issue swallowing, fever, chills, and a hoarse voice. In extreme circumstances, the epiglottis can swell a lot that it blocks the airway, inflicting issue respiratory.
  • Causes: Epiglottitis is normally attributable to a bacterial an infection, equivalent to Haemophilus influenzae kind b (Hib). Nevertheless, it can be attributable to different micro organism, viruses, or accidents to the throat.
  • Remedy: Epiglottitis is a medical emergency. Remedy sometimes entails antibiotics to kill the micro organism inflicting the an infection, in addition to steroids to scale back irritation. In extreme circumstances, a tracheotomy could also be essential to create an airway.
  • Prevention: The Hib vaccine may also help to stop epiglottitis attributable to Haemophilus influenzae kind b. This vaccine is advisable for all kids.

Epiglottitis is a severe situation, however it’s normally treatable if identified and handled promptly. Nevertheless, in Washington’s time, there have been no antibiotics or different efficient remedies for epiglottitis. Consequently, his demise was not sudden.

Different theories exist

Along with the official reason behind demise, there are a variety of different theories about what might have killed George Washington. These theories vary from the believable to the outlandish.

  • Medical malpractice: Some historians imagine that Washington’s docs might have hastened his demise by utilizing outdated and dangerous remedies, equivalent to bloodletting and calomel. These remedies might have weakened Washington’s immune system and made him extra inclined to an infection.
  • Poisoning: A couple of historians have steered that Washington might have been poisoned, both deliberately or by chance. Nevertheless, there isn’t any proof to help this declare.
  • Anthrax: One principle is that Washington died from anthrax, a bacterial an infection that may be contracted from animals. This principle relies on the truth that Washington had been inspecting his livestock shortly earlier than he turned ailing. Nevertheless, there isn’t any definitive proof to help this principle both.
  • Diphtheria: One other principle is that Washington died from diphtheria, a bacterial an infection of the throat and respiratory tract. This principle relies on the truth that Washington’s signs have been just like these of diphtheria. Nevertheless, once more, there isn’t any definitive proof to help this principle.

It’s possible that we’ll by no means know for sure what prompted George Washington’s demise. Nevertheless, the varied theories which have been proposed present a glimpse into the historic context of his demise and the challenges that docs confronted within the 18th century.
